    Quote Originally Posted by bchunter View Post
    Thanks for the replys. I think I'll save a little longer and hold out for a tweed jacket in an argyle-type style, at least for church and other more reserved outings. I might still get the peitean, though, for games and the such.
    I think that is a good idea. While wearing the kilt will almost always make you stand out, IMHO it is OK to stand out for dressing differently but not to stand out for dressing inappropriately. I wouldn't go to church without a jacket and tie if I was wearing trousers so I wouldn't do it wearing a kilt either.
